Home
last modified time | relevance | path

Searched refs:parser_state_tos (Results 1 – 25 of 33) sorted by relevance

12

/dports/devel/gindent/indent-2.2.12/src/
H A Dparse.c216parser_state_tos->cstk[parser_state_tos->tos] = parser_state_tos->cstk[parser_state_tos->tos - 1]; in inc_pstack()
337 parser_state_tos->il[parser_state_tos->tos] = parser_state_tos->i_l_follow; in parse()
361 parser_state_tos->i_l_follow = parser_state_tos->il[parser_state_tos->tos]; in parse()
371 parser_state_tos->il[parser_state_tos->tos] = parser_state_tos->ind_level; in parse()
438 parser_state_tos->il[parser_state_tos->tos] = parser_state_tos->ind_level; in parse()
445 parser_state_tos->il[parser_state_tos->tos] = parser_state_tos->i_l_follow; in parse()
452 parser_state_tos->i_l_follow = parser_state_tos->il[parser_state_tos->tos]; in parse()
480 parser_state_tos->ind_level = parser_state_tos->il[parser_state_tos->tos]; in parse()
515 parser_state_tos->il[parser_state_tos->tos] = parser_state_tos->i_l_follow; in parse()
537 parser_state_tos->il[parser_state_tos->tos] = parser_state_tos->ind_level; in parse()
[all …]
H A Dhandletoken.c381 if (parser_state_tos->in_decl && !parser_state_tos->block_init) in handle_token_lparen()
410 parser_state_tos->paren_indents[parser_state_tos->p_l_follow - 1] = in handle_token_lparen()
601 if (parser_state_tos->p_stack[parser_state_tos->tos] != dohead) in handle_token_rparen()
1025 parser_state_tos->in_stmt = (parser_state_tos->p_l_follow > 0); in handle_token_semicolon()
1165 if (parser_state_tos->in_decl && parser_state_tos->in_or_st) in handle_token_lbrace()
1238 parser_state_tos->paren_indents[parser_state_tos->p_l_follow - in handle_token_lbrace()
1269 if (((parser_state_tos->p_stack[parser_state_tos->tos] == decl) && in handle_token_rbrace()
1272 (parser_state_tos->p_stack[parser_state_tos->tos] == casestmt)) in handle_token_rbrace()
1364 if (parser_state_tos->p_stack[parser_state_tos->tos] == stmtl) in handle_token_rbrace()
1392 if (!parser_state_tos->in_decl && (parser_state_tos->tos <= 0) && in handle_token_rbrace()
[all …]
H A Dlexi.c242 parser_state_tos->col_1 = parser_state_tos->last_nl; in lexi()
243 parser_state_tos->last_saw_nl = parser_state_tos->last_nl; in lexi()
253 parser_state_tos->col_1 = false; in lexi()
491 parser_state_tos->last_rw_depth = parser_state_tos->paren_depth; in lexi()
510 !(parser_state_tos->noncast_mask & 1 << parser_state_tos->p_l_follow)) in lexi()
513 parser_state_tos->cast_mask |= 1 << parser_state_tos->p_l_follow; in lexi()
524 !(parser_state_tos->noncast_mask & 1 << parser_state_tos->p_l_follow)) in lexi()
527 parser_state_tos->cast_mask |= 1 << parser_state_tos->p_l_follow; in lexi()
588 if (parser_state_tos->last_token == ident && parser_state_tos->last_saw_nl) in lexi()
662 !parser_state_tos->p_l_follow && !parser_state_tos->block_init && in lexi()
[all …]
H A Doutput.c873 parser_state_tos->paren_indents[parser_state_tos->p_l_follow - 1] += in dump_line_code()
1016 if (parser_state_tos->procname[0] && !parser_state_tos->classname[0] && in dump_line()
1021 else if (parser_state_tos->procname[0] && parser_state_tos->classname[0] && in dump_line()
1150 parser_state_tos->decl_on_line = parser_state_tos->in_decl; in dump_line()
1154 parser_state_tos->ind_stmt = parser_state_tos->in_stmt; in dump_line()
1170 parser_state_tos->ind_level = parser_state_tos->i_l_follow; in dump_line()
1171 parser_state_tos->paren_level = parser_state_tos->p_l_follow; in dump_line()
1183 *paren_targ = -parser_state_tos->paren_indents[parser_state_tos->paren_level - 2]; in dump_line()
1187 *paren_targ = -parser_state_tos->paren_indents[parser_state_tos->paren_level - 1]; in dump_line()
1511 if (parser_state_tos->pcase) in compute_label_target()
[all …]
H A Dindent.c145 parser_state_tos->search_brace = false; in sw_buffer()
168 while (parser_state_tos->search_brace) in search_brace()
372 parser_state_tos->procname = "\0"; in search_brace()
373 parser_state_tos->procname_end = "\0"; in search_brace()
374 parser_state_tos->classname = "\0"; in search_brace()
375 parser_state_tos->classname_end = "\0"; in search_brace()
430 parser_state_tos->in_decl && in search_brace()
431 (parser_state_tos->procname[0] != '\0')) in search_brace()
485 can_break = parser_state_tos->can_break; in indent_main_loop()
488 parser_state_tos->last_saw_nl = false; in indent_main_loop()
[all …]
H A Dcomments.c178 parser_state_tos->box_com = 1; in print_comment()
235 parser_state_tos->tos--; in print_comment()
245 parser_state_tos->com_col = 1; in print_comment()
264 parser_state_tos->com_col = 1; in print_comment()
272 parser_state_tos->tos--; in print_comment()
314 (!parser_state_tos->in_stmt || in print_comment()
315 (parser_state_tos->in_decl && (parser_state_tos->paren_level == 0)))) in print_comment()
340 if (parser_state_tos->decl_on_line) in print_comment()
526 parser_state_tos->tos--; in print_comment()
672 parser_state_tos->tos--; in print_comment()
[all …]
/dports/devel/gindent/indent-2.2.12/regression/input/
H A Dparse.c229 parser_state_tos->il[parser_state_tos->tos] = parser_state_tos->i_l_follow;
249 = parser_state_tos->il[parser_state_tos->tos];
254 parser_state_tos->il[parser_state_tos->tos]
308 parser_state_tos->il[parser_state_tos->tos] = parser_state_tos->ind_level;
312 parser_state_tos->il[parser_state_tos->tos] = parser_state_tos->i_l_follow;
323 parser_state_tos->il[parser_state_tos->tos]
330 parser_state_tos->il[parser_state_tos->tos] = parser_state_tos->i_l_follow;
373 parser_state_tos->il[parser_state_tos->tos] = parser_state_tos->i_l_follow;
394 parser_state_tos->il[parser_state_tos->tos]
511 parser_state_tos->i_l_follow = parser_state_tos->il[parser_state_tos->tos]; in reduce()
[all …]
H A Dindent.c195 parser_state_tos->ind_level = parser_state_tos->i_l_follow = col;
523 if (parser_state_tos->in_decl && !parser_state_tos->block_init)
633 if (parser_state_tos->p_stack[parser_state_tos->tos]
831 parser_state_tos->in_decl = (parser_state_tos->dec_nest > 0);
859 parser_state_tos->in_stmt = (parser_state_tos->p_l_follow > 0);
909 parser_state_tos->ind_level = parser_state_tos->i_l_follow;
915 if (parser_state_tos->in_decl && parser_state_tos->in_or_st)
963 if (parser_state_tos->p_stack[parser_state_tos->tos] == decl
982 parser_state_tos->in_stmt = parser_state_tos->ind_stmt = false;
994 if (parser_state_tos->p_stack[parser_state_tos->tos] == dohead
[all …]
H A Dpr_comment.c83 parser_state_tos->com_col = 1; in pr_comment()
103 parser_state_tos->com_col in pr_comment()
134 parser_state_tos->com_col = parser_state_tos->decl_on_line in pr_comment()
154 if (parser_state_tos->box_com) in pr_comment()
156 parser_state_tos->n_comment_delta = 1 - parser_state_tos->com_col; in pr_comment()
191 parser_state_tos->last_nl = 0; in pr_comment()
196 if (!parser_state_tos->box_com) in pr_comment()
224 if (parser_state_tos->box_com || parser_state_tos->last_nl) in pr_comment()
266 parser_state_tos->com_col in pr_comment()
270 parser_state_tos->com_col = 2; in pr_comment()
[all …]
H A Dlexi.c190 parser_state_tos->col_1 = parser_state_tos->last_nl; in lexi()
191 parser_state_tos->last_nl = false; in lexi()
270 parser_state_tos->last_u_d = true; in lexi()
319 parser_state_tos->last_u_d = true; in lexi()
334 parser_state_tos->cast_mask in lexi()
348 parser_state_tos->cast_mask in lexi()
374 && parser_state_tos->tos <= 1 in lexi()
423 && !parser_state_tos->p_l_follow in lexi()
424 && !parser_state_tos->block_init in lexi()
432 parser_state_tos->last_u_d = true; in lexi()
[all …]
H A Dio.c95 if (parser_state_tos->procname[0]) in dump_line()
104 fprintf (output, ".Pr \"%.*s\"\n", parser_state_tos->procname_end - parser_state_tos->procname, in dump_line()
105 parser_state_tos->procname); in dump_line()
116 if (parser_state_tos->use_ff) in dump_line()
119 parser_state_tos->use_ff = false; in dump_line()
207 parser_state_tos->paren_indents[parser_state_tos->p_l_follow - 1] in dump_line()
364 parser_state_tos->decl_on_line = parser_state_tos->in_decl; in dump_line()
368 parser_state_tos->ind_stmt = (parser_state_tos->in_stmt in dump_line()
375 parser_state_tos->ind_level = parser_state_tos->i_l_follow; in dump_line()
376 parser_state_tos->paren_level = parser_state_tos->p_l_follow; in dump_line()
[all …]
H A Dcomments1.c58 while (parser_state_tos->p_stack[parser_state_tos->tos] == ifhead
64 parser_state_tos->p_stack[parser_state_tos->tos] = stmt;
74 parser_state_tos->search_brace = btype_2;
76 if (parser_state_tos->p_stack[parser_state_tos->tos] != decl)
/dports/devel/gindent/indent-2.2.12/regression/standard/
H A Dparse.c228 parser_state_tos->il[parser_state_tos->tos] =
248 = parser_state_tos->il[parser_state_tos->tos];
253 parser_state_tos->il[parser_state_tos->tos]
306 parser_state_tos->il[parser_state_tos->tos] =
311 parser_state_tos->il[parser_state_tos->tos] =
323 parser_state_tos->il[parser_state_tos->tos]
330 parser_state_tos->il[parser_state_tos->tos] =
396 parser_state_tos->il[parser_state_tos->tos]
484 = parser_state_tos->il[parser_state_tos->tos]; in reduce()
513 parser_state_tos->il[parser_state_tos->tos]; in reduce()
[all …]
H A Dindent.c194 parser_state_tos->ind_level = parser_state_tos->i_l_follow = col;
519 if (parser_state_tos->in_decl && !parser_state_tos->block_init)
541 parser_state_tos->paren_indents[parser_state_tos->p_l_follow - 1]
824 parser_state_tos->in_decl = (parser_state_tos->dec_nest > 0);
852 parser_state_tos->in_stmt = (parser_state_tos->p_l_follow > 0);
902 parser_state_tos->ind_level = parser_state_tos->i_l_follow;
908 if (parser_state_tos->in_decl && parser_state_tos->in_or_st)
955 if (parser_state_tos->p_stack[parser_state_tos->tos] == decl
974 parser_state_tos->in_stmt = parser_state_tos->ind_stmt = false;
986 if (parser_state_tos->p_stack[parser_state_tos->tos] == dohead
[all …]
H A Dpr_comment.c83 parser_state_tos->com_col = 1; in pr_comment()
103 parser_state_tos->com_col in pr_comment()
133 parser_state_tos->com_col = parser_state_tos->decl_on_line in pr_comment()
153 if (parser_state_tos->box_com) in pr_comment()
155 parser_state_tos->n_comment_delta = 1 - parser_state_tos->com_col; in pr_comment()
190 parser_state_tos->last_nl = 0; in pr_comment()
195 if (!parser_state_tos->box_com) in pr_comment()
223 if (parser_state_tos->box_com || parser_state_tos->last_nl) in pr_comment()
265 parser_state_tos->com_col in pr_comment()
269 parser_state_tos->com_col = 2; in pr_comment()
[all …]
H A Dlexi.c187 parser_state_tos->col_1 = parser_state_tos->last_nl; in lexi()
188 parser_state_tos->last_nl = false; in lexi()
266 parser_state_tos->last_u_d = true; in lexi()
314 parser_state_tos->last_u_d = true; in lexi()
329 parser_state_tos->cast_mask in lexi()
343 parser_state_tos->cast_mask in lexi()
369 && parser_state_tos->tos <= 1 in lexi()
417 && !parser_state_tos->p_l_follow in lexi()
418 && !parser_state_tos->block_init in lexi()
426 parser_state_tos->last_u_d = true; in lexi()
[all …]
H A Dio.c95 if (parser_state_tos->procname[0]) in dump_line()
106 parser_state_tos->procname, parser_state_tos->procname); in dump_line()
117 if (parser_state_tos->use_ff) in dump_line()
120 parser_state_tos->use_ff = false; in dump_line()
209 parser_state_tos->paren_indents[parser_state_tos->p_l_follow - in dump_line()
367 parser_state_tos->decl_on_line = parser_state_tos->in_decl; in dump_line()
371 parser_state_tos->ind_stmt = (parser_state_tos->in_stmt in dump_line()
372 & ~parser_state_tos->in_decl); in dump_line()
378 parser_state_tos->ind_level = parser_state_tos->i_l_follow; in dump_line()
379 parser_state_tos->paren_level = parser_state_tos->p_l_follow; in dump_line()
[all …]
H A Dcomments1-fca.c58 while (parser_state_tos->p_stack[parser_state_tos->tos] == ifhead
64 parser_state_tos->p_stack[parser_state_tos->tos] = stmt;
74 parser_state_tos->search_brace = btype_2;
76 if (parser_state_tos->p_stack[parser_state_tos->tos] != decl)
H A Dcomments1.c58 while (parser_state_tos->p_stack[parser_state_tos->tos] == ifhead
64 parser_state_tos->p_stack[parser_state_tos->tos] = stmt;
74 parser_state_tos->search_brace = btype_2;
76 if (parser_state_tos->p_stack[parser_state_tos->tos] != decl)
/dports/games/ldmud/ldmud-3.3.720/src/util/indent/
H A Dparse.c79 parser_state_tos->il[parser_state_tos->tos] = parser_state_tos->i_l_follow;
97 parser_state_tos->i_l_follow = parser_state_tos->il[parser_state_tos->tos];
102parser_state_tos->il[parser_state_tos->tos] = parser_state_tos->ind_level = parser_state_tos->i_l_…
151 parser_state_tos->il[parser_state_tos->tos] = parser_state_tos->ind_level;
155 parser_state_tos->il[parser_state_tos->tos] = parser_state_tos->i_l_follow;
161parser_state_tos->ind_level = parser_state_tos->i_l_follow = parser_state_tos->il[parser_state_tos
164parser_state_tos->il[parser_state_tos->tos] = parser_state_tos->ind_level = parser_state_tos->i_l_…
169 parser_state_tos->il[parser_state_tos->tos] = parser_state_tos->i_l_follow;
195parser_state_tos->ind_level = parser_state_tos->i_l_follow = parser_state_tos->il[--parser_state_t…
207 parser_state_tos->il[parser_state_tos->tos] = parser_state_tos->i_l_follow;
[all …]
H A Dindent.c127 parser_state_tos->want_blank = parser_state_tos->in_stmt = parser_state_tos->ind_stmt = false;
128 parser_state_tos->procname = parser_state_tos->procname_end = "\0";
251 parser_state_tos->ind_level = parser_state_tos->i_l_follow = col;
419 parser_state_tos->out_lines, parser_state_tos->out_coms);
500 if (parser_state_tos->in_decl && !parser_state_tos->block_init)
541 parser_state_tos->sizeof_mask |= 1 << parser_state_tos->p_l_follow;
545 …if (parser_state_tos->cast_mask & (1 << parser_state_tos->p_l_follow) & ~parser_state_tos->sizeof_…
811 parser_state_tos->ind_level = parser_state_tos->i_l_follow;
863 parser_state_tos->in_stmt = parser_state_tos->ind_stmt = false;
873parser_state_tos->search_brace = cuddle_else && parser_state_tos->p_stack[parser_state_tos->tos] =…
[all …]
H A Dpr_comment.c95 parser_state_tos->box_com = true; in pr_comment()
96 parser_state_tos->com_col = 1; in pr_comment()
111 parser_state_tos->com_col = (parser_state_tos->ind_level - unindent_displace) + 1; in pr_comment()
126parser_state_tos->com_col = parser_state_tos->decl_on_line || parser_state_tos->ind_level == 0 ? d… in pr_comment()
144 if (parser_state_tos->box_com) { in pr_comment()
176 parser_state_tos->last_nl = 0; in pr_comment()
181 parser_state_tos->use_ff = true; in pr_comment()
205 if (parser_state_tos->box_com || parser_state_tos->last_nl) { /* if this is a boxed comment, in pr_comment()
234 parser_state_tos->last_nl = 1; in pr_comment()
243 parser_state_tos->com_col = ((parser_state_tos->ind_level - unindent_displace) in pr_comment()
[all …]
H A Dlexi.c129 parser_state_tos->col_1 = parser_state_tos->last_nl; /* tell world that this token started in in lexi()
131 parser_state_tos->last_nl = false; in lexi()
200 parser_state_tos->last_u_d = true; in lexi()
235 if (parser_state_tos->p_l_follow) in lexi()
244 if (parser_state_tos->p_l_follow) { in lexi()
245 parser_state_tos->cast_mask |= 1 << parser_state_tos->p_l_follow; in lexi()
264 if (*buf_ptr == '(' && parser_state_tos->tos <= 1 && parser_state_tos->ind_level == 0) { in lexi()
280 && !parser_state_tos->p_l_follow in lexi()
282 && (parser_state_tos->last_token == rparen || parser_state_tos->last_token == semicolon || in lexi()
284 parser_state_tos->last_token == lbrace || parser_state_tos->last_token == rbrace)) { in lexi()
[all …]
H A Dio.c59 parser_state_tos->procname); in dump_line()
61 parser_state_tos->ind_level = 0; in dump_line()
135 parser_state_tos->paren_indents[parser_state_tos->p_l_follow-1] in dump_line()
143 parser_state_tos->paren_indents[i] = -(parser_state_tos->paren_indents[i] + target_col); in dump_line()
243 parser_state_tos->comment_delta = parser_state_tos->n_comment_delta; in dump_line()
248 if (parser_state_tos->use_ff) in dump_line()
256 ++parser_state_tos->out_lines; in dump_line()
268parser_state_tos->ind_stmt = parser_state_tos->in_stmt & ~parser_state_tos->in_decl; /* next line … in dump_line()
277 parser_state_tos->ind_level = parser_state_tos->i_l_follow; in dump_line()
278 parser_state_tos->paren_level = parser_state_tos->p_l_follow; in dump_line()
[all …]
/dports/devel/gindent/indent-2.2.12/
H A DChangeLog-199876 and `parser_state_tos->last_token' is doublecolon.
191 `parser_state_tos->i_l_follow'.
243 `parser_state_tos->com_col' is set.
264 `parser_state_tos->last_token'.
279 `parser_state_tos->il', `parser_state_tos->cstk', and
280 `parser_state_tos->paren_indents'.
551 being `parser_state_tos->in_decl'.
845 `parser_state_tos->ind_level' and `parser_state_tos->i_l_follow'
946 set `parser_state_tos->n_comment_delta' to
1028 (parser_state_tos->paren_depth > 0).
[all …]

12